Bridging Gynecology and Cardiology for Better Women’s Health
The Gynecologist’s Guide to Cardiology in Women is a practical, evidence-based clinical guide by Dr A M Thirugnanam that helps gynecologists, obstetricians, cardiologists, and physicians understand the unique cardiovascular challenges faced by women throughout their lives.
Featuring 18 comprehensive chapters and 222 pages, this book covers the diagnosis, prevention, and management of cardiovascular disease in women—from adolescence and reproductive years to pregnancy, menopause, and healthy aging.
The book explains how hormonal changes, pregnancy-related complications, menopause, pol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S), contraception, infertility treatments, hypertension, diabetes, obesity, autoimmune disorders, and lifestyle factors influence cardiovascular risk. It also discusses maternal cardiac disease, cardio-obstetrics, congenital heart disease in pregnancy, preeclampsia, gestational hypertension, peripartum cardiomyopathy, venous thromboembolism, anticoagulation, and cardiovascular emergencies during pregnancy.
Special emphasis is placed on early diagnosis, cardiovascular risk assessment, preventive cardiology, multidisciplinary management, and evidence-based clinical guidelines.
